A Victorian engraved gilt-brass strut timepiece with calendar
Thomas Cole, London, No. 739; retailed by C.F. Hancock, London. Circa 1850
The rectangular case finely engraved with scrolling foliage on a hatched ground, Cole's serial number 739 punch-numbered on the base with swivel stand, the backplate with further easle stand and engraved C.F. Hancock. A successor of STORR & MORTIMER'S by appointment to H.M. Queen Adelaide HJM the Emporer of Russia 59 Bruton Street London, the foliate engraved silvered dial with Roman chapter, the centre engraved with the monogram (addorsed P) beneath a Baronet's coronet, retail signature above for C.F. HANCOCK LONDON, calendar below with manually adjustable days of the week, the eight-day movement with ratchet tooth lever escapement and plain steel balance, the interior case mouldings stamped THOs COLE LONDON
5½ in. (14 cm.) high
